More about Dr. Judith Bin-Nun, PhD, LMFT, LPCC

I provide supportive, creative, and caring psychotherapy for children, adolescents, and adults – couples, families, individuals. STUDIO ART EXPERIENCE for individuals and groups takes place in my Venice Studio, FOOD FOR THOUGHT cooking therapy classes for groups and individuals takes place in my Venice “greenhouse kitchen”, SOCIAL SKILLS GROUPS and PLAY THERAPY, PARENT GUIDANCE, COUPLES WORK AND INDIVIDUAL PSYCHOTHERAPY are held at my Art Studio/Playroom. My Venice Offices and Art Studio/Play Therapy Room on Milwood Ave. Venice, California 90291-3830 I am an experienced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(LMFT), Licensed Professional Clinical Counselor (LPCC), and Clinical Child Psychologist Ph.D. In addition to my basic office-based treatment for adults and children, I offer Art Experience, Social Skills Groups for children from pre-school through adolescence, and adult groups for Art Exploration and “Food for Thought” Cooking Therapy. “Food for Thought” Cooking Therapy is my unique approach to sharing: reconnecting memories, opening inner worlds to patients on the path of self-discovery, and journal writing specific thoughts and feelings during artistic and creative cooking expression. My approach to children and parent guidance comes from my training as a child development specialist, play therapist with over 50 years of experience as an educator, school principal, teacher, group worker, art teacher, and psychotherapist. I have been a teacher and curriculum developer, school principal, author and have been in private psychotherapy practice for thirty-five years. My practice is open for referrals. In addition, I am a member of “Pet Partners” with my 3 Registered Therapy Dogs and utilize them in my practice of psychotherapy. Animal Assisted Therapy is goal-directed and my registered therapy dogs, small Brussels Griffons, are trained to work with specific complex patients.
